An 18-year-old Kronum resident has been discovered dead following a fire outbreak in the Ashanti Region's Afigya Kwabre South District.
According to reports, the 18-year-old attempted to save his father’s apartment during a ravaging fire on Saturday.
The residents earlier raised fears he may have been trapped in the inferno following his attempt to use an extinguisher to salvage the property.
Firefighters who returned to the scene of the incident to control the inferno found the body of the 18-year-old in the rubble.
“The fire crew on the ground just confirmed that the remains of the 18-year-old who was struck in the fire has been retrieved,” a source told JoyNews.
The fire which started around 2:00 pm extended to at least six houses, destroying more than 50 apartments.
The fire also completely destroyed a 10-bedroom structures.
The Ashanti Regional PRO for the Fire Service, D03 Peter Addai confirmed to JoyNews that the fire started within a plastic recycling plant in the facility.
"Little information we picked from the ground from the brother of the owner of the facility suggests that the fire started within the facility," he said.
According to him, reports indicate that the owner of the factory suffered minor injuries, adding that he is currently at the hospital for treatment.
